1- Take 2 wires (blk w/red & wht w/red) from the stator and plug them directly into CDI box (same color wires)

2- CDI wires (plug orange and black) Run orange wire to hot lead on coil and ground the black wire

3- The black wire left on the CDI goes to a ground

4- Make sure to run ground from engine to frame

If you have an aftermarket Kill Switch- Run 1 lead to ground and other wire to hot lead on coil. Be careful not to run hot lead on coil to wire on killswitch that runs to the metal exposed part of the killswitch.

Step 2 is referring to the wires from the CDI which are joined into a white plug

1 is and orange/peach color and the other is black...

Cut the plug off and ground the black to the frame and run the orange wire direct to the lead on the coil


You could at this time also join the other black wire from the CDI with this black wire and ground into 1 eyelet

You could also take the hot lead from the kill tether and join as one into one plug with the orange wire going to the coil
